VOCs治理过程中在线废气浓度检测仪表的选型分析 被引量:6

Analysis on the Selection of Appropriate Instrument for Online Detection of Exhaust Gas Concentration in the Process of VOCs Treatment
下载PDF
导出
摘要 VOCs治理过程中废气浓度若积累到一定程度容易引发爆炸事故,造成人身伤害和经济损失,因此选择合适的仪表对废气浓度进行在线检测至关重要。对催化燃烧法,红外吸收法和激光二极管法的工作原理及性能指标进行了深入分析比较,并介绍了三种原理的工程应用案例,最后提出VOCs治理过程中在线废气浓度检测仪表的选型建议,以期供选用者参考。 During the process of VOCs treatment, the explosion may happen if the concentration of exhaust gas reaches a critical level, which can lead to huge economic loss and personal injuries. So it is crucial to choose an appropriate instrument for online detection of the concentration of exhaust gas. In this paper, the working principle, performance indexes and application cases of catalytic combustion method, infrared absorption method and laser diode method were analyzed and compared. And some advice on the selection of instrument for online detection of the concentration of exhaust gas was put forward.
